In the recent 2016 Michelin Guides, the hotel group was awarded a total of 16 stars worldwide, across eleven restaurants. 

For the Mandarin Oriental, this figure could still increase (or decrease), since the 2016 guide for France is due to be published in Q1 of 2016.

Sur Mesure at the Mandarin Oriental, Paris currently holds two Michelin stars. Should the restaurant be awarded three stars this year, then the hotel group’s overall win will increase to 17.

The Mandarin Oriental group is currently increasing its hold in the MENA region, including reported launches in Beirut, Marrakech and also Dubai by 2017. The global hotel group's Michelin prowess could be the push needed to bring the French guides to the Gulf.

Culinary titans such as British chef Heston Blumenthal, and French chef Pierre Gagnaire, have been responsible for boosting the Mandarin Oriental’s Michelin ranking.

Heston Blumenthal now holds two stars for Dinner by Heston Blumenthal at the Mandarin Oriental Hyde Park, London.

Pierre Gagnaire, who also has two outlets in Dubai, and one in KSA, has earnt two stars for Pierre at the Mandarin Oriental, Hong Kong.

In total, the flagship Mandarin Oriental property in Hong Kong holds a total of four stars: two for restaurant Pierre, one for Cantonese restaurant Man Wah, and one star for Mandarin Grill + Bar.
